#1ab307 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1ab307 is composed of 10.2% red, 70.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 113.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#1ab307 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ff0e with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#1ab307 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1ab307 has RGB values of R:26, G:179,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1749767.

Hex triplet 1ab307 #1ab307
RGB Decimal 26, 179, 7 rgb(26,179,7)
RGB Percent 10.2, 70.2, 2.7 rgb(10.2%,70.2%,2.7%)
CMYK 85, 0, 96, 30
HSL 113.4°, 92.5, 36.5 hsl(113.4,92.5%,36.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 113.4°, 96.1, 70.2
Web Safe 33cc00 #33cc00
CIE-LAB 63.732, -64.28, 63.114
XYZ 16.584, 32.473, 5.595
xyY 0.303, 0.594, 32.473
CIE-LCH 63.732, 90.085, 135.524
CIE-LUV 63.732, -58.319, 77.215
Hunter-Lab 56.985, -47.778, 34.069
Binary 00011010, 10110011,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#1ab307

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010900 is the darkest color, while #f6fff5 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1ab307 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#727272 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#607f5d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b39f00 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c69830 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#5daab7 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7ba602 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#87a121 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#44ad77 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
